Portuguese Air Force (FAP) Nord-2501 D

The air force of Portugal assigns serial 6416 to a 2501 D, and the aircraft dates to 1966 while bearing the GA+235 identity. From 1960 through 1977 Portugal fields 28 Nord-2501/2502 airframes, including 13 of the 2501 D that come from the Luftwaffe.

Yakovlev Yak-18 Soviet Air Force Trainer

Yakovlev Yak-18 serves as a Soviet tandem two-seat primary trainer, configured to deliver instruction with a Shvetsov M-11FR-1 radial engine rated at 119 kW (160 hp). A Chinese-produced version exists as the Nanchang CJ-5, expanding the aircraft's international footprint.

US Marines F/A-18 VMFAT-101 Devilfish

VMFAT-101 carries a Devilfish tail on the F/A-18 Hornet, linking the Sharpshooters to Marine Aviation Logistics Squadron 11. The unit undergoes commissioning at Marine Corps Air Station El Toro in 1969, and by 1990 graduates over 150 Hornet aircrew and logs more than 28,000 flight hours across the A, B, C, and D models.
